Inflation remains a pressing challenge for many economies worldwide. As prices soar, central banks often resort interest rate hikes as a key strategy to control inflation's spread.
- By raising interest rates, central banks seek to make borrowing dearer. This can reduce consumer and business spending, which in turn can slow down inflation.
- However, interest rate hikes can also have adverse consequences for economic growth. A sharp increase in rates can cause a slowdown.
Therefore, central banks must deliberately calibrate interest rate increases to strike a balance between limiting inflationary pressures and fostering expansion.

Inflation's Pink Tax: Fighting Back in a High-Cost World
For women everywhere, the present economic climate is particularly tough. While inflation impacts everyone, it particularly affects products typically marketed towards women. This phenomenon, known as the "pink tax," reveals the ongoing gender inequality in pricing.
Alarmingly, everyday items like shaving cream and garments can be substantially more costly for females. This extra cost not only places a financial burden on buyers, but it also perpetuates harmful gender stereotypes and promotes inequity.
There are, however, ways to fight this problem.
- Speaking out for policies that prohibit gender-based pricing is crucial.
- Choosing businesses that offer equal pricing for all consumers.
- Sharing information about the pink tax to inform others.
Finally, by standing together, we can defeat the pink tax and build a fairer society.

The Cost of Being Female: Combating the Pink Tax During Inflation
Inflation is hitting everyone hard, but for women, the impact can be particularly acute. This is due more info in part to the persistent "Pink Tax," a phenomenon where products marketed towards women are often costlier than comparable products for men. From razors and shampoo to clothing and haircuts, women are consistently spending more for everyday essentials simply because they are labeled as feminine. While it might seem like a small difference, these added costs add up over time, creating a significant financial disparity for women.
The Pink Tax compounds existing inequalities and perpetuates harmful gender stereotypes. By recognizing this issue, we can implement solutions to combat it. This includes supporting policies that promote price transparency, investigating gender-based pricing practices, and educating women to savvy purchasing decisions.
